The introduction of agentic AI into the enterprise resource planning (ERP) space is set to underpin the era of the autonomous enterprise, according to Nazia Pillay, MD of 麻豆原创 Southern Africa.

Click the button below to load the content from YouTube.

ITWeb TV: Agentic AI is fueling rise of the autonomous enterprise | Ep #151

Pillay spoke to ITWeb TV recently about AI-infused ERP, the autonomous enterprise concept 鈥 which relies on an army of AI agents at its core 鈥 and how organisations need to adapt to benefit from the opportunity.

鈥淎utonomous ERP is not just about using AI to engage with end-users, to assist with navigation and pull data back; it is also about seeing agents as co-workers 鈥 systems that are working and performing tasks from end to end with human oversight,鈥 she said.

Pillay added that this fundamental shift requires change management for both human employees and business processes.

鈥淵ou are adopting a technology that fundamentally needs to be embedded, and your business processes need to be adapted for how you want to use this in your business,” she said. “That鈥檚 the main thing that our customers are facing 鈥 they need to look at this as a transformation and not just as a plug-and-play technology.鈥

Pillay cautioned that curiosity about AI does not necessarily indicate organisational readiness. Success, she said, comes down to understanding business objectives and getting data foundations in place.

鈥淢ost of our customers are trying to figure out how to navigate this technology 鈥 how do I introduce it and how do I do it in a way that is adding value,” she said. “What we鈥檝e found is that when they use AI as a proof of concept or an experiment, they are not leveraging the full value of the technology.鈥

Beyond experimentation, governance frameworks are essential, Pillay said.

鈥淢ost of the organisations that we are speaking to need to look at how they are deploying it at an enterprise level, because when you are just deploying it as a proof of concept, you don鈥檛 necessarily need to have all those frameworks in place.鈥

Pillay said the wealth of data that clients have generated through 麻豆原创 installations provides a good foundation for companies shifting towards the autonomous enterprise.

鈥淲hat we know about AI is that it requires context 鈥 so you need to understand where the data is and how it is being used, and this we already have based on our knowledge graphs within 麻豆原创,” she said.

鈥淭he second part is governance 鈥 what 麻豆原创 puts into place to ensure that we have security. We have invested because we have the context and the governance to support our customers in having agents run in a responsible, reliable way.鈥

With AI agents being deployed across end-to-end business processes, getting governance right will be key, she concluded.
